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Inclusion Criteria:
  • Diagnosis of CD established at least 12 weeks before screening including both endoscopic evidence and a histopathology report consistent with a diagnosis of CD
  • Moderately to severely active CD based on CDAI criteria, defined as baseline (Week I-0) CDAI score \>=220 but \<=450 and either mean daily SF count \>=4, or mean daily AP score \>=2
  • Moderately to severely active CD based on SES-CD criteria assessed by baseline (Week I-0) endoscopic evidence of active ileal and/or colonic CD as assessed during central review of the screening video ileocolonoscopy defined as a SES-CD \>= 6 for participants with colonic or ileocolonic disease, and SES-CD \>= 4 for participants with isolated ileal disease, based on the presence of ulceration in any 1 of the 5 ileocolonic segments
  • A female participant of childbearing potential must have a negative highly sensitive serum pregnancy test (beta-hCG) at screening and a negative urine pregnancy test at Week I-0 prior to administration of study intervention and agree to further pregnancy tests
  • Demonstrated an inadequate response, loss of response, or failure to tolerate previous conventional therapy (advanced drug therapy \[ADT\]-naïve) or advanced therapy defined as biologics and/or advanced oral agents for the treatment of CD (ADT-inadequate responder \[IR\]) as defined in the protocol
  • Exclusion criteria:
  • Has complications of CD, such as symptomatic strictures or stenoses, short gut syndrome, or any other manifestation, that may require surgery while enrolled in the study and/or could impair the use of instruments (such as CDAI) to assess response to study intervention
  • Presence of a stoma or ostomy
  • Participants with presence of active fistulas may be included if there is no surgery needed
  • Colonic resection within 24 weeks before baseline or any other major surgery performed within 12 weeks before baseline
  • Presence on screening colonoscopy of adenomatous colon polyps outside of an area of known colitis not removed before randomization
